Axis Bank replaces Bank of India as trustee bank for NPS

07 May 2013 Evaluate

Axis Bank will replace state-run Bank of India (BoI) as the ‘trustee bank’ for the National Pension System (NPS) from July onwards. According to Pension Fund Regulatory and Development Authority (PFRDA), the public sector lender has been 'appointed as the new NPS Trustee Bank with effect from July 1, 2013 in place of Bank of India (current Trustee Bank)' for the period of two years.

However, Bank of India was appointed as ‘Trustee Bank’ for NPS for 5 years. Nevertheless, at discretion of PFRDA/NPS Trust, the contract can be renewed annually for another maximum tenure of three years. NPS Trust is responsible for handling funds under the NPS. The Trust holds accounts with the bank designated as ‘NPS Trustee Bank’.
